01RR47Z is a billable procedure code used to specify the performance of replacement of sacral nerve with autologous tissue substitute, percutaneous endoscopic approach. The code is valid for the year 2025 for the submission of HIPAA-covered transactions. The procedure code involves putting in or on biological or synthetic material that physically takes the place and/or function of all or a portion of a body part. Procedure code explanation: the body part may have been taken out or replaced, or may be taken out, physically eradicated, or rendered nonfunctional during the replacement procedure. a removal procedure is coded for taking out the device used in a previous replacement procedure total hip replacement, bone graft, free skin graft

In an PCS table each code is represented by up seven alphanumeric characters, with each character in the table respresenting different aspects of the procedure. In the table provided below, each row represents an individual character and includes information about the character's position, designation, label, and procedure notes. For this PCS table the procedure code is in the medical and surgical section and is part of the peripheral nervous system body system, classified under replacement operation. The applicable bodypart for this procedure code is sacral nerve.

What is ICD-10-PCS?
The ICD-10 Procedure Coding System (ICD-10-PCS) is a catalog of procedural codes used by medical professionals for hospital inpatient healthcare settings. The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services (CMS) maintain the catalog in the U.S. releasing yearly updates. The 2025 ICD-10-PCS codes are to be used for discharges occurring from October 1, 2024 through September 30, 2025.
Each ICD-10-PCS code has a structure of seven alphanumeric characters and contains no decimals. The first character defines the major "section". Depending on the "section" the second through seventh characters mean different things.
